首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]掌握Python计算字符串长度:轻松学会三招,告别长度计算难题

发布于 2025-06-24 12:30:19
0
1170

引言在Python编程中,字符串长度的计算是一个基础而又常用的操作。了解如何高效地计算字符串长度对于编写各种程序至关重要。本文将介绍三种简单易行的方法来计算Python字符串的长度,帮助你轻松掌握这一...

引言

在Python编程中,字符串长度的计算是一个基础而又常用的操作。了解如何高效地计算字符串长度对于编写各种程序至关重要。本文将介绍三种简单易行的方法来计算Python字符串的长度,帮助你轻松掌握这一技能。

方法一:使用内置函数 len()

Python提供了一个内置函数 len(),它可以用来获取任何可迭代对象(包括字符串)的长度。这是最简单直接的方法。

代码示例

# 定义一个字符串
my_string = "Hello, World!"
# 使用len()函数计算字符串长度
length = len(my_string)
# 打印结果
print("字符串长度为:", length)

输出

字符串长度为: 13

方法二:使用字符串索引

Python中的字符串可以通过索引来访问其字符。字符串索引从0开始,因此可以通过访问最后一个字符的索引来计算字符串的长度。

代码示例

# 定义一个字符串
my_string = "Hello, World!"
# 计算字符串长度
length = len(my_string) - 1
# 打印结果
print("字符串长度为:", length)

输出

字符串长度为: 13

方法三:遍历字符串

虽然这种方法不是最高效的,但它提供了一种理解字符串如何工作的方式。你可以遍历字符串中的每个字符,直到遇到字符串结束的标志。

代码示例

# 定义一个字符串
my_string = "Hello, World!"
# 初始化计数器
length = 0
# 遍历字符串中的每个字符
for char in my_string: length += 1
# 打印结果
print("字符串长度为:", length)

输出

字符串长度为: 13

总结

通过上述三种方法,你可以轻松地在Python中计算字符串的长度。使用内置函数 len() 是最快捷的方式,而使用字符串索引和遍历则可以加深你对字符串操作的理解。掌握这些方法,你将能够更加自信地处理字符串长度相关的编程任务。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流